Core Faculty


The members of the graduate faculty in Health Informatics represent a broad range of interests within the general area of computing in biology and medicine. All faculty participate in the teaching, research, and service activities of the program and the University. They are also among the leaders within the professional community, serving on executive boards of major professional scholarly journals, and as consultants to the health care industry. Many have been recognized professionally as Fellows and Senior Members of learned societies.
